Government House in Nassau is set on 10 acres, not huge (about the same size as Clarence House in London, where Charles & Camilla currently live) but certainly a decent size for 2 people. Fun fact: During her time in the Bahamas, the duchess started a new fashion trend - seashells studded with jewels and used as earrings, brooches and clasps on necklaces. The jewelers that made the pieces Wallis designed had their store on the Main Street (still selling those seashell earrings) until Nassau decided to clean up downtown and raise the rents. All the family-owned stores closed and now you only have duty-free and T-shirt stores that cater to the cruise ship people.
